What is a weekend container terminal vessel planner?

A Weekend Container Terminal Vessel Planner is a logistics professional responsible for organizing and coordinating the loading and unloading of cargo containers from ships at a port terminal, specifically during weekend shifts. They create vessel stowage plans, optimize container placement for efficient handling, and work closely with operations teams to ensure timely turnaround of vessels. Their role is crucial for maintaining smooth terminal operations and minimizing vessel delays, especially during busy or off-peak periods like weekends.

What are the main challenges faced by weekend container terminal vessel planners, and how can they be managed effectively?

Weekend Container Terminal Vessel Planners often encounter challenges such as managing unexpected vessel schedule changes, coordinating with various teams during off-peak hours, and efficiently allocating berth and yard resources under tight time constraints. Effective communication with operations, stevedores, and shipping lines is crucial to ensure smooth cargo flow and minimize delays. Being proactive in monitoring ship arrivals and departures, using terminal operating systems efficiently, and quickly adapting to last-minute changes are key strategies for overcoming these challenges and ensuring vessel turnaround targets are met.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end container terminal vessel planner?

To thrive as a Weekend Container Terminal Vessel Planner, you need strong analytical abilities, attention to detail, and a background in logistics or maritime operations, often supported by relevant certifications or experience. Proficiency with terminal operating systems (TOS), planning software like Navis N4, and cargo management tools is typical for this role. Excellent problem-solving, communication, and teamwork skills help you manage last-minute changes and coordinate with various stakeholders. These skills ensure efficient vessel turnaround, minimize operational delays, and maintain safety and productivity in a dynamic port environment.

Good Shepherd Community Care is one of the most trusted health care organizations in Greater Boston focusing on hospice and palliative care. Founded as Hospice of the Good Shepherd in 1978, we are the original Massachusetts hospice. After decades of caring for our community, we continue to remain an independent, not-for-profit, non-sectarian organization.
